How many cubic millimeter in 1 gram [sugar]?
The answer is 1173.552765377.
We assume you are converting between cubic millimetre and gram [sugar].

The SI derived unit for volume is the cubic meter.
1 cubic meter is equal to 1000000000 cubic millimeter, or 852113.36848478 gram [sugar].

The cubic millimeter is a metric measure of volume or capacity equal to a cube 1 millimeter on each edge.
This is the amount of sugar, often measured as 4.2 grams per teaspoon on a nutrition facts label.
